How about something vaguely inspired by the first Grandia or Fable? The Adventurer's Society has called all you brave knights, mages and general heroes (plus a few villains that managed to creep in) to this shiny fantasy world and wants you to go explore it, reporting back on everything they find or fight. Characters turn up at the society where they're briefed on the world and introduced to their new/ altered powers and roles before being turned loose on the world. Events could be things like dragon attacks, demonic armies, tournaments, the works. Non-combat-oriented characters could take healing, tactical or information gathering roles- becoming an emissary or translator for hidden villages, for example, or documenting the flora and fauna of the world.
